Immortal Quote by Emily Dickinson
“IMMORTAL is an ample word When what we need is by, But when it leaves us for a time, 'Tis a necessity.”
About This Quote
Source Poem: Unknown collection, date unknown
The poem contrasts the idea of immortality with the temporary nature of life, suggesting that death can be a necessary pause.
In simple terms: Immortality is grand, but sometimes we need a break; death is a pause.
